Output d8bd5d72cade344651f6dada89a183d3d941853cbb82deb998b1b29fc43af54e:1

value
432551592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 313e7e036afd2e3f15a73bbbba30712b8a61d68c OP_EQUAL
address
36BPtypEsxdUEntH8TP2NVzDj3QJjLrDLd
transaction
d8bd5d72cade344651f6dada89a183d3d941853cbb82deb998b1b29fc43af54e
confirmations
243818
spent
true